FLASH COMUNICACIONES IC-729 CON PROBLEMAS DE DDS
ICOM IC-729 that arrived with a 400 Hz offset. Another technician attempted to adjust the reference oscillator without success. Since the problem was in a DDS, the maximum power output was around 60 watts. The receiver was somewhat insensitive, and the noise blanker was not working. Equipment repaired and fully calibrated to 10%.
